  • Nicaragua

    NCC partners together with Agros International to develop a long-term relationship with a community in Nicaragua called Tierra Nueva. This relationship began by sending a leader team down to Nicaragua in 2012. Since then, NCC has sent mission teams each year into this community to continue to develop this relationship. This annual trip is safe for families because the focus is in building relationships and fostering community between our church and this community. It is a blessing to see the people of Tierra Nueva working their families out of poverty by becoming land owners in Nicaragua.  


    The last trip was the spring of 2018, and since then trips have been put on hold due to COVID-19.  A potential 2022 trip is being explored and more information will be communicated soon.

  • Ghana

    In 2016, NCC celebrated 10 years of supporting Pioneers Africa in Ghana. Did you know...in 2004 there was an unmanned health clinic with no doctor anywhere for 50-100 miles? NCC funded the first doctor; that clinic now runs on its own with government funding. Thousands of villagers have had access to healthcare to heal their bodies. People are working on building a water packaging facility with NCC's help, so they can earn funds to become more self-sufficient and reach even more villagers.


    In April 2019, a small team traveled to Ghana to deliver book bags filled with commentaries and to teach 40 pastor/missionary leaders. Watch the video to hear from some of the Ghana leaders share their appreciation.

  • In the past, God has enabled NCC to be involved with various organizations and have sent over 25 mission teams to Armenia, China, Costa Rica, Ghana, Haiti, India, Nicaragua, Thailand, Venezuela and West Virginia
  • Together, we have aided in planting churches in India, China and Vietnam.
  • Provided dental clinics in China, Ghana, and Haiti
  • Been instrumental in helping the construction of water wells and a bottling facility to create a self-sustaining business mission in Ghana
  • Contributed resources to having The Good and Beautiful Life series translated into Farsi
  • Funded a medical doctor for a clinic in Ghana that now runs on its own with government funding
  • Helped create a self-sustaining agricultural community in Nicaragua
  • Built/renovated houses and playgrounds in Haiti and West Virginia

  • Compassion Day

    When we organize Compassion Days, we unite as a church body to show the love of Christ in practical ways with no strings attached. During these days of service, we go out in teams of 8 - 15 people into our community and perform service projects for organizations, our mission partners, and the under privileged. Some of the projects in the past have included repairs, landscaping, visiting with elderly, collecting furniture, handing out water bottles in North Park, preparing meals, and even washing fire trucks.

  • Baby Bottle Campaign

    New Community Church participates in an annual Baby Bottle Campaign to raise money for the Women's Choice Network (WCN)  to empower abortion-vulnerable women to choose life. WCN Centers provide pregnancy testing, STD testing and treatment, sonograms, medical consultations, and life-saving options to abortion-vulnerable women. WCN services also include post-abortion care and abstinence education; all services are offered under the direction of a professional medical staff and are provided to all clients at no charge.
